Stratos Smart Card Aims to Combine All in One

Stratos are looking forward to make your credit cards, debit cards, loyalty cards, and gift cards a thing of past. It will combine all of the cards in one.

Stratos is a kind of electronic 'smart' card that has assured the simplification of lives by slimming down our wallets and securing our personal information.

The working of this card is very simple. A corresponding mobile app will store all your current credit card information and will transmit to your Stratos Card whenever you want to pay. When you receive this card in the mail, it comes with a card reader that can be plugged into a phone's headphone jack.

You can load the card's information in the app by swiping a traditional credit card, debit card or gift card through the reader.

The app can save any number of cards but the Stratos Card holds only three cards for quick access. Thiago Olson, CEO and co-founder of Stratos, told CNNMoney that most people only use three cards 95% of the time.

There are three touch-sensors on the front of the card that correspond to each quick access card, and thus allow you to choose which one you want to use with a few taps. Stratos will require a Bluetooth connection to your smartphone, if you're not using one of those three cards.

Stratos Card is very similar to a traditional credit card, but it is as thin and light as a business card and has a slick and clean design.

The Stratos Card is safe as it uses bank-level encryption, and for added security it generates a new, unique credit card "token" number every time it's used. After the bank receives and decrypts that "token," it charges your card. The best thing is that the retailer can never see your actual credit card number.

The Stratos Card will cost $95 a year, or $145 for a two-year upfront membership. According to Stratos, this fee includes the cost of manufacturing, plus the cloud storage and security of the card, which is checked by the company. It is available for pre-order now, and the shipping will begin in April.
